informatica:arduino:matrix_led
This is an old revision of the document!
Panel Matrix led
Hay varias bibliotecas (que no librerías)
Ejemplo 1
https://microcontrollerslab.com/led-dot-matrix-display-esp32-max7219/
Bibliotecas: MD_MAX72XX by MajicDesigns and MD_Parola de MajicDesigns
PANEL | ESP32 |
---|---|
VCC | Vin |
GND | GND |
DIN | GPIO23 |
CS | GPIO5 |
CLK | GPIO18 |
#include <MD_Parola.h> #include <MD_MAX72xx.h> #include <SPI.h> // Uncomment according to your hardware type #define HARDWARE_TYPE MD_MAX72XX::FC16_HW //#define HARDWARE_TYPE MD_MAX72XX::GENERIC_HW // Defining size, and output pins #define MAX_DEVICES 4 #define CS_PIN 5 MD_Parola Display = MD_Parola(HARDWARE_TYPE, CS_PIN, MAX_DEVICES); void setup() { Display.begin(); Display.setIntensity(0); Display.displayClear(); } void loop() { Display.setTextAlignment(PA_LEFT); Display.print("ESP32"); delay(2000); Display.setTextAlignment(PA_CENTER); Display.print("ESP32"); delay(2000); Display.setTextAlignment(PA_RIGHT); Display.print("ESP32"); delay(2000); Display.setTextAlignment(PA_CENTER); Display.setInvert(true); Display.print("ESP32"); delay(2000); Display.setInvert(false); delay(2000); }
informatica/arduino/matrix_led.1666649034.txt.gz · Last modified: 2022/10/24 22:03 by jose